J-18, Sector 18, , Noida - 201301, Uttar Pradesh, India
Shop No 7, Sector 27, , Noida - 201301, Uttar Pradesh, India
Nihari, Sector 31, , Noida - 201303, Uttar Pradesh, India
B-1/31 R Plaza, Noida Sector 50, , Noida - 201307, Uttar Pradesh, India
A65 Nehru Garden, Sector 57, , Noida - 201301, Uttar Pradesh, India